关于python:打印特定格式的列表项

Printing list items within a specific format

本问题已经有最佳答案,请猛点这里访问。

我有一份清单,包括:

1
lst = [10,20,30,40]

我想把它打印成这样的形式:

1
output: 10 --> 20 --> 30 --> 40

我试着写:

1
print("output:" +"-->".join(lst))

但我在说str格式是必需的时出错了。希望能得到一些帮助。


尝试如下操作:

1
print(*lst, sep=' --> ')

1
2
3
lst = [10,20,30,40]

print("-->".join(str(x) for x in lst))

输出:

10——>20——>30——>40